Output 603c416cf17c75a06a1927ba42fb6de4eea8e19d489e29e3ecc690ad593a89d6:0

value
1557346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ce8268ac5f7f4ff3a2a9d2ce0b256eacf1031c29 OP_EQUAL
address
3LWwM2cgncWnco3oWhwRB7VMyGVWGuwSdp
transaction
603c416cf17c75a06a1927ba42fb6de4eea8e19d489e29e3ecc690ad593a89d6
confirmations
364203
spent
true